Grand Rapids

American  

noun

  1. a city in SW Michigan: furniture factories.


adjective

  1. noting or pertaining to mass-produced furniture of generally low quality.

Grand Rapids British  

noun

  1. (functioning as singular) a city in SW Michigan: electronics, car parts. Pop: 195 601 (2003 est)
